Visual Studio代码Python条件语句问题

Visual Studio代码Python条件语句问题,python,if-statement,visual-studio-code,Python,If Statement,Visual Studio Code,嗨,我是编程新手,目前正在通过LinkedIn学习Python,我一直在学习其中一个示例代码 def main(): a, b = 1, 10 if(a < b): st = "x is LESSER than y" print(st) def main(): a、 b=1,10 如果(a

嗨,我是编程新手,目前正在通过LinkedIn学习Python,我一直在学习其中一个示例代码

def main():
    a, b = 1, 10
    if(a < b):
        st = "x is LESSER than y"
    print(st)
def main():
a、 b=1,10
如果(a

它甚至没有显示任何错误消息,所以我现在很困惑。(我的解释器是Python 3.7.4)

您刚刚创建了一个函数。您需要调用函数才能执行

而不是使用变量,您可以直接打印,除非绝对必要。 调用函数
main()

def main():
a、 b=1,10
如果a
您正在调用
main()
?对于简单的if布尔表达式,不要使用大括号
()
,这不是Java/C++/JavaScript/C#
def main():
    a, b = 1, 10
    if a < b:
        print("a is LESSER than b")

main()